Course Details

Secure Space Communication Fundamentals: An introduction to the principles and best practices of secure communication in space networks. This unit covers the basics of space communication, security requirements, and potential threats.
Cryptographic Techniques in Space Communication: This unit explores various cryptographic techniques used to secure space communication, including symmetric and asymmetric encryption, digital signatures, and key management.
Secure Satellite Network Architectures: An overview of different secure network architectures for space communication, including mesh, star, and hybrid topologies. This unit also covers network security protocols and standards.
Physical Layer Security in Space Communication: This unit focuses on physical layer security techniques, such as spread spectrum, frequency hopping, and beamforming, to protect against eavesdropping and interference.
Secure Space Communication Protocols: A deep dive into various secure communication protocols used in space networks, including CCSDS (Consultative Committee for Space Data Systems) and MIL-STD (Military Standard) protocols.
Secure Space Communication Hardware and Software: An examination of the hardware and software components used in secure space communication systems, including antennas, modems, and encryption devices.
Risk Management in Secure Space Communication: This unit covers risk management strategies and techniques to identify, assess, and mitigate potential security risks in space communication systems.
Secure Space Communication Regulations and Compliance: An overview of the legal and regulatory landscape governing secure space communication, including national and international laws and standards.
Emerging Trends in Secure Space Communication: This unit explores the latest trends and innovations in secure space communication, including quantum cryptography, blockchain, and machine learning-based security solutions.
